Sintassi del file delle pagine di destinazione

L'elemento principale del file delle pagine di destinazione è <PointsOfSale>, che richiede uno elemento secondario <PointOfSale> e non ha attributi. Un file delle pagine di destinazione può avere più elementi secondari <PointOfSale>.

Ogni pagina di destinazione definita nel file delle pagine di destinazione è inclusa in un Elemento <PointOfSale>. Questo elemento utilizza un singolo attributo, id, che definisce un identificatore univoco per una pagina di destinazione. Puoi utilizzare il valore di id per filtrare le pagine di destinazione idonee per un hotel corrispondente. Puoi farlo utilizzando l'elemento <AllowablePointsOfSale> in <Transaction>.

Sintassi

<?xml version="1.0" encoding="UTF-8"?>
<PointsOfSale>
  <PointOfSale id="landing_page_id">
    <DisplayNames display_text="landing_page_display_name" display_language="language_code"/>
    <Match status="[yes|never]"
      country="country_code"
      language="language_code"
      brand="booking_engine or brand"
      currency="currency_code"
      sitetype="[localuniversal|mapresults]"
      device="[desktop|mobile|tablet]"/>
    <!-- The dynamic landing page URL -->
    <URL>landing_page_url</URL>
  </PointOfSale>
</PointsOfSale>

Nella tabella seguente vengono descritti gli elementi secondari dell'elemento <PointOfSale>:

Elemento Obbligatorio Descrizione
<DisplayNames> Optional

Contiene il testo visualizzato per le agenzie di viaggi online. Questo elemento utilizza i seguenti attributi:

  • display_text: contiene il testo visualizzato in un un annuncio o un link di prenotazione gratuito. Deve essere il nome del partner.
  • display_language: un il codice lingua a due lettere specifica la lingua di visualizzazione dell'annuncio. o un link di prenotazione gratuito. Il valore di questo attributo deve corrispondere a un lingua supportata specificata dal <Match> .

L'esempio seguente mostra un nome visualizzato per un'agenzia di viaggi online francese:

  <DisplayNames
    display_text="TravelAgency.com.fr"
    display_language="fr"
  />

Escludi l'elemento <DisplayNames> per le conversioni centrali Fornitori di sistemi di prenotazione (CRS), chiamati anche "integrazioni partner" e fornitori diretti come proprietari o catene di hotel. Per questi tipi di partner, il testo degli annunci e dei link di prenotazione gratuiti viene preso l'elemento <Name> dell'hotel nell'elenco hotel.

Nota: per gli OTA, se hai configurato un nome visualizzato predefinito con l'Assistenza Google, questo campo è facoltativo. In caso contrario, gli OTA devono fornire <DisplayNames>.

<Match> Required

Definisce i filtri che determinano se mostrare annunci e link di prenotazione gratuiti visualizzate in base a varie caratteristiche dell'utente o dell'hotel. Per Ad esempio, puoi specificare che venga visualizzato un annuncio o un link di prenotazione gratuito solo agli utenti di un determinato paese.

Questo elemento utilizza i seguenti attributi:

  • status: determina se una corrispondenza include o esclude i risultati per il criterio specificato. I valori validi sono yes (deve corrispondenza) o never (non deve corrispondere).
  • country: corrisponde al dominio Google associato a tra l'utente e l'hotel. Questo attributo accetta un codice paese di due lettere. Ad esempio, US o FR.
  • language: stabilisce una corrispondenza in base alla lingua dell'utente e dell'hotel. Questo prende un codice lingua di due lettere. Ad esempio, en o fr.
  • brand: stabilisce una corrispondenza in base al valore dell'attributo hotel_brand specificato nel tuo elenco di hotel. Questo filtro può essere utile se avere URL diversi per i tuoi sistemi di prenotazione o per vari brand.
  • currency: corrisponde alla valuta del paese dell'utente o dell'hotel. Questo attributo accetta un codice valuta di tre lettere. Ad esempio: USD o EUR.
  • sitetype: corrisponde alla proprietà Google su cui viene generata una l'utente ha visualizzato i dati sui prezzi dei tuoi hotel. Questo attributo accetta quanto segue valori:
    • localuniversal: l'utente ha trovato l'annuncio o la prenotazione senza costi tramite una ricerca, di solito effettuando la ricerca su google.com.
    • mapresults: l'utente ha trovato il link di prenotazione dell'hotel tramite maps.google.com.
  • device: stabilisce una corrispondenza in base al tipo di dispositivo utilizzato dall'utente per eseguire ricerche. Questo attributo richiede mobile, desktop o tablet.

    NOTA: non puoi impostare status su never se device è impostato su tablet.

Ad esempio:

<PointOfSale id="test1">
  <Match status="yes" country="US"/>
  <Match status="yes" currency="USD"/>
  <Match status="yes" device="mobile"/>
  <Match status="yes" language="en"/>
  <URL>www.google.com</URL>
</PointOfSale>

Puoi combinare gli attributi dell'elemento <Match> per semplificare le regole di corrispondenza, come illustrato nell'esempio seguente:

<PointOfSale id="test1">
  <Match
    status="yes"
    country="US"
    language="en"
    currency="USD"
    device="mobile"/>
  <URL>www.google.com</URL>
</PointOfSale>

Per ulteriori informazioni, consulta Pagine di destinazione regole di corrispondenza.

<URL> Required Definisce un link al tuo sito in cui l'utente può prenotare una camera. Tu può inserire come query informazioni dinamiche sull'utente e sul suo itinerario parametri di stringa. Ad esempio, puoi includere l'ID hotel utilizzando il parametro Variabile PARTNER-HOTEL-ID nell'URL:
http://partner.com/landing?hid=(PARTNER-HOTEL-ID)

Quando questo link viene creato e mostrato all'utente, Google sostituisce la variabile PARTNER-HOTEL-ID con il valore ID hotel. Quando l'utente raggiunge il sito mediante click-through, i valori di tutti i parametri della stringa di query possono essere estratti ed elaborati per ottimizzare l'esperienza utente. Per un elenco completo delle variabili consentite Nell'URL pagina di destinazione, consulta Utilizzo di variabili e condizioni.

Quando utilizzi il monitoraggio, specifica l'URL completo, inclusi i componenti necessari per il monitoraggio. Ad esempio:

https://example.tracker.com?campaign_id=(CAMPAIGN-ID)&amp;t_url=
http://partner.com/landing%3Fhid%3D(PARTNER-HOTEL-ID)

Non è possibile utilizzare parametri ValueTrack in <URL>.

Puoi definire un solo elemento <URL> per ogni pagina di destinazione.

<LPURL> Optional

Utilizzato per supportare il monitoraggio dinamico nell'URL pagina di destinazione. Specifica il segmento non di monitoraggio dell'URL definito nell'URL <URL> . I segmenti di monitoraggio dell'URL pagina di destinazione devono essere specificati utilizzando Google Modelli di monitoraggio di Google Ads disponibili nel tuo account Google Ads e il suffisso URL finale. Se gli URL di monitoraggio non sono presenti in Google Google Ads, l'elemento <LPURL> viene ignorato.

Non è necessario inserire caratteri di escape per il valore <LPURL>. R la configurazione ValueTrack corretta in Google Ads fa precedere da una sequenza di escape automaticamente. Ad esempio:

http://partner.com/landing?hid=(PARTNER-HOTEL-ID)

Non è possibile utilizzare parametri ValueTrack in <LPURL>. Per ulteriori informazioni, vedi Impostare il monitoraggio dinamico per una campagna per hotel.

Lo schema del file delle pagine di destinazione definisce la struttura e i vincoli di un file delle pagine di destinazione. Per ulteriori informazioni, consulta Schemi di Hotel Ads